Applications
2-Octene, 8-methoxy-2,6-dimethyl- (CAS 55915-70-3) is primarily used as a chemical intermediate in the synthesis of aroma-related compounds; in practice it may serve as an odor-active intermediate or fragrance ingredient in perfumery. It can be evaluated for use in cosmetics and personal care formulations as a fragrance component. In household and cleaning products, it may be employed to contribute fragrance profiles. In industrial manufacturing, it is often used as a building block in the production of specialty chemicals, flavor/aroma compounds, or related intermediates. In polymers and plastics development, it may function as a reactive intermediate or precursor for specialty polymers or crosslinking agents. All applications are subject to local regulations and formulation limits.
